Estevan is the eleventh-largest city in Saskatchewan, Canada It is approximately 16 kilometres (9 9 mi) north of the Canada–United States border The Souris River runs by the city This city is surrounded by the Rural Municipality of Estevan No 5

Estevan, city, southeastern Saskatchewan, Canada It lies along the Souris River at the latter’s junction with Long Creek, just north of the border with the U S state of North Dakota, about 125 miles (200 km) southeast of Regina

Estevan became a major point along the North-West South-East trade route Thanks to this fortunate placing, by 1899, Estevan was incorporated as a village In 1906, it became a town as its population swelled to 600
